Community Participation in Greenway

How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.

One in twenty residents in Greenway have served in the Defence Force, a rate that is among the highest for similar areas. While military service is common, other forms of community contribution are less frequent, with volunteering and unpaid care rates sitting well below the territory average.

Participation

Volunteering for organisations and groups.

Volunteering has dropped by 4.4 percentage points since 2011 to 13.2%. This is lower than most areas and sits well below the ACT figure of 18.4%.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

Unpaid care is much lower than most areas, with only 21.7% of people caring for children and 15.5% doing at least 15 hours of housework. These figures are both well below the national and territory averages.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

Defence service is common here, with 5.4% of people having served. This is a little above the Australian figure of 2.8% and about the same as the ACT average.
